What Is Tooth Laser Whitening?

Tooth laser whitening is a modern cosmetic dental procedure that utilizes laser technology to enhance the natural whiteness of teeth. Unlike traditional bleaching methods, which may require multiple visits or longer treatment times, laser whitening provides a quick, effective, and less invasive way to brighten teeth in a single session. It involves applying a specialized whitening gel to the teeth, which is then activated by a laser light. The laser energizes the whitening agents in the gel, breaking down stains and discoloration efficiently.

How Does the Procedure Work?

The process of tooth laser whitening typically involves several carefully executed steps to ensure optimal results and patient comfort:

  1. Initial Consultation: A comprehensive dental examination is conducted to assess your oral health, identify any issues that need addressing prior to whitening, and establish realistic expectations.
  2. Preparation: The teeth are cleaned thoroughly to remove plaque and surface stains. Protective barriers are placed on the gums to shield soft tissues from the whitening gel and laser exposure.
  3. Application of Whitening Gel: A high-concentration peroxide gel is carefully applied to the teeth's surfaces.
  4. Laser Activation: A specialized laser light is directed at the gel-coated teeth. The laser energizes the peroxide, breaking down staining molecules and whitening the teeth rapidly.
  5. Rinse and Evaluation: The gel is removed, and the dentist assesses the shade change. Additional treatments may be performed if necessary to achieve the desired brightness.
  6. Post-Treatment Care: Instructions are provided on maintaining your newly whitened smile and avoiding stain-causing foods and beverages.

Factors Influencing the Effectiveness of Tooth Laser Whitening

While tooth laser whitening is highly effective, several factors can influence the final results:

  • Initial Tooth Color: Naturally lighter teeth may respond better and achieve a more noticeable whitening effect.
  • Type of Stains: Surface stains from foods, beverages, and smoking tend to respond better than intrinsic stains caused by aging, medication, or trauma.
  • Oral Hygiene Practices: Maintaining good oral health enhances and prolongs whitening results.
  • Diet and Lifestyle: Avoiding stain-producing substances after treatment helps preserve the brightness.
  • Number of Sessions: Sometimes, multiple sessions may be needed for optimal results, especially for significant discoloration.

Safety and Potential Side Effects of Tooth Laser Whitening

When performed by qualified dental professionals, tooth laser whitening is a safe procedure with minimal risks. However, some individuals may experience temporary side effects such as:

  • Tooth Sensitivity: Mild sensitivity to temperature or certain foods can occur but usually resolves within a few days.
  • Gum Irritation: The protective barriers minimize gum irritation, but some patients may experience minor discomfort.
  • Uneven Whitening: In some cases, uneven results can occur if there are pre-existing dental restorations like crowns or veneers.

To minimize these risks, it is essential to choose an experienced cosmetic dentist and disclose all oral health information during consultation. Proper post-treatment care enhances safety and longevity of results.

Who Is an Ideal Candidate for Tooth Laser Whitening?

Most healthy adults with stained or discolored teeth are excellent candidates for tooth laser whitening. Ideal candidates typically:

  • Have good overall oral health without active gum disease or cavities.
  • Possess teeth that are naturally white or lightly discolored.
  • Want quick, noticeable results in a single appointment.
  • Are committed to maintaining good oral hygiene and avoiding stain-causing foods.

Those with significant intrinsic staining or existing dental restorations may require adjunctive treatments such as veneers or crowns for a uniform appearance.

Long-Term Maintenance of Your Whitened Smile

To preserve the results of tooth laser whitening, patients are encouraged to adopt healthy habits:

  • Brush teeth at least twice daily with a whitening toothpaste.
  • Floss daily to prevent plaque buildup.
  • Avoid or limit consumption of stain-causing foods and drinks such as coffee, tea, red wine, berries, and dark sauces.
  • Refrain from smoking or using tobacco products.
  • Schedule regular dental checkups for professional cleaning and ongoing maintenance.
  • Consider touch-up treatments as recommended by your dentist to maintain brightness over time.
